The simple guide to making a package holiday accident claim
No one wants or expects to get injured on holiday but accidents do happen.
As long as your holiday was booked as part of a package and was the result of someone elses negligence, you could bring a claim against your tour operator for any accidents that took place within your hotel.
You can also make a claim for any accidents which happened on a trip or during travel organised by your tour operator.
The most common types of holiday accidents are:
- Slips, trips and falls within the hotel grounds
- Balcony fall accidents
- Road traffic accidents e.g. during coach transport to or from your hotel.

What evidence do I need to make a claim?
The first thing you should do after you have received the medical attention you need is to report your accident to your tour operator representative. Ask them for a copy of the report they make on your accident as this can be used to support your case.
To help our holiday accident solicitors get you the compensation you deserve, we always ask for as much information as possible. This can include:
- Photographs of where the accident took place
- Witness statements from anyone who saw the accident
- Records of any medical treatment you received
- Receipts of any medical treatment you paid for.
